Optimizing Readability for Fast-Paced Digital Campaigns
While the aesthetic appeal is undeniable, practical application requires careful attention to readability, especially when using Balap across different screen sizes. Because this dynamic Decorative typeface features distinct character shapes designed for impact, it works best as a headline tool rather than body copy. When testing the responsive layouts, I ensured that the Fonts maintained their clarity on smaller mobile viewports by increasing line height and avoiding overcrowding. For digital product creators building course sales pages or campaign landing pages, the rule of thumb is to let Balap shine in short, punchy phrases where its velocity can be fully appreciated without overwhelming the user's scanning behavior.

Strategic Font Pairing for Balanced Web Layouts
To make the most of Balap without creating visual chaos, pairing it with a neutral counterpart is essential for a professional UI design. Since this dynamic Decorative typeface carries so much character weight, I paired it with a clean, humanist sans serif for the body text to ensure the content remained easy to digest. This contrast allows the Fonts to perform their specific roles: Balap captures attention and sets the tone, while the supporting typeface handles the heavy lifting of information delivery. For blog redesigns or portfolio homepages, this combination ensures that the artistic flair of the display font does not compromise the accessibility of the article content or case study details.
